diff --git a/portainer/api.py b/portainer/api.py index 4ea3692..51e5839 100644 --- a/portainer/api.py +++ b/portainer/api.py @@ -658,12 +658,14 @@ class PortainerApi: autostart=False, stack_mode="swarm", ): + diff_stacks = ['mediacenter'] for stack in stacks: - if self.endpoint_name == "nas": - server = "_nas" - else: - server = "" - + server = "" + if stack in diff_stacks: + if self.endpoint_name == "nas": + server = "_nas" + elif self.endpoint_name == "m-server": + server = "_m-server" if stack_mode == "swarm": swarm_id = self.get_swarm_id(endpoint) p = "swarm"